*
{
    font-family: Arial, Helvetica, sans-serif;
}

body
{
    background-color: whitesmoke;
}

p
{
    font-size: 1.5vw;
}

content div
{
    padding: 0.5vw;
    margin: 0.5vw;
    background-color: white;
}

table, th, td
{
    border: 1px solid black;
    border-collapse: collapse;
    padding:4px;
}

aside
{
    display: flex;
    flex-direction: row;
}

a
{
    color: orange;
}

explore
{
    display: inline-block;
    box-shadow: 0 3px 1px -2px rgba(0, 0, 0, 0.14), 0 2px 2px 0 rgba(0, 0, 0, 0.098), 0 1px 5px 0 rgba(0, 0, 0, 0.084);
    margin-left: 10px;
    padding: 10px;
    border-radius: 3px;
}

code
{
    font-size: 1.4vw;
}

.selectionLinks
{
    font-size: 2vw;
}

.selectionLinks li ul li
{
    font-size: 1.5vw;
}

.inline
{
    display: inline;
}